Regarding the receipt of the investigative report by the investigation committee.
Nitto Denko Corporation (Headquarters: Osaka, President: Hideo Takasaki, hereinafter referred to as "the Company") established a committee of external experts to investigate the "improper conduct regarding the certification system for our membrane modules for water supply" (hereinafter referred to as the "improper conduct"), which was announced on January 5, 2024.
We have received the "Investigation Report" regarding this investigation and would like to report the following.
1. Results of the Investigation
According to this report, it is unlikely that the improper conduct will have any impact on water users, as it does not produce results that do not meet the criteria laid down in the Ministry of Health, Labour and Welfare Ordinance. However, the following proposals have been put forward as preventive measures against recurrence.
- 1) Declaration of the need for a management reform by the management team
- 2) Acquisition of specialized knowledge and skills
- 3) Examination of the department in charge of certification-related work
- 4) Creation of a system for passing down work duties
- 5) Need of certification by the Membrane Society
- 6) Appropriate allocation of personnel
- 7) Sharing of information
- 8) Active use of "Kurumaza"
- 9) Understanding of the basic concept of quality and promotion of the quality management system.
(For details, please refer to the attached "Chapter 6: Proposals for Preventing Recurrence" in the investigation report.)
